H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E P.NAVEEN RAO WRIT PETITION Nos.39608, 39638 & 39654 of 2015 COMMON ORDER:

Notification No.2 of 2013 was issued calling for applications for enlistment to various categories of posts in the respondent University including posts of Assistant Professors in several disciplines. The petitioners came out successfully in the selections conducted and, accordingly, by orders, dated 26.10.2013, they were issued appointment orders. These appointment orders were kept in abeyance by orders of the competent authority, dated 28.10.2013. The said abeyance orders were earlier challenged before this Court in W.P.No.6006 of 2014. This Court passed interim orders. However, during the pendency of the said writ petition, the Governing Council has taken a decision to cancel the entire selection in pursuant to the Advertisement No.2 of 2013. The petitioners challenge the decision of the Governing Council cancelling the entire selection in pursuant to the Advertisement No.2 of 2013.

2. In W.P.No.5107 of 2015 & batch, the decision of the Governing Council of the respondent University cancelling the entire selection is challenged. This Court, by judgment, dated 13.11.2015, allowed the writ petitions. This Court held as under: "20. Having gone through the contentions urged in the counter affidavit, I am of the view that the irregularities pointed out are not material and the selection process is in accordance with the notification

issued for the said posts. As already said, absolutely there is no malpractice, manipulation or fraud in the process of selection. If that is so, the entire select list cannot be cancelled to the detriment of the meritorious candidates. This is not a case wherein it is not possible to segregate the properly selected candidates from improperly selected candidates even by following the rule of reservation. On the pretext that some mistakes occurred in the process of selection, the entire selection process shall not be annulled. As pointed out by the Hon'ble Supreme Court in the judgments referred supra, if the selection process is tainted with corrupt practices, manipulations and fraud, then only the entire selection can be cancelled.

In the instant case, absolutely, even according to the respondents, there are no corrupt practices, manipulations or fraud played in the process of selection. Most of the petitioners are working as contract lecturers in the respondentsUniversity. If they are selected fairly in accordance with the norms indicated in the notification, they cannot be denied appointment on the grounds viz., rule of reservation has not been followed, no cut-off marks were prescribed, some ineligible candidates were given appointment etc. The counter affidavit does not mention about any specific irregularities candidate-wise.

Apparently, it seems that the basis for cancellation of the select list is nothing but the Note issued by the then Deputy Chief Minister of the erstwhile State of Andhra Pradesh and the fax message sent by the State Government. No specific irregularity has been pointed out by the Sub Committee appointed by the Governing Council of the respondents-University. Since the petitioners were given appointment orders, they shall be absorbed in the said posts unless it is shown that any taint, malpractice or fraud is attached to their selection or that they were not properly selected for their respective posts.

21. In view of what all stated herein above, the resolution of the Governing Council of the respondentsUniversity cancelling the entire selection process in pursuance of Advertisement No.2/2013 is declared as

illegal and it is set aside. Consequently, the respondents are directed to examine the select list thoroughly, apply the rule of reservation and segregate the candidates who are improperly selected from the properly selected candidates and appoint the petitioners according to their merit and by applying the rule of reservation pursuant to their respective appointment orders. With the above directions, all the writ petitions are disposed of. The miscellaneous petitions, if any, pending in these writ petitions shall stand closed. No costs."

3. When the matters are taken up, learned counsel for the petitioners as well as the learned Assistant Government Pleader, learned Standing Counsel representing the respondent University have stated that the subject matters of the writ petitions are covered by the decision of this Court in W.P.No.5107 of 2015 and batch.

4. Having regard to the same and following the earlier decision of this Court, the Writ Petitions are disposed of. The cancellation of the entire selection process in pursuant to the Advertisement No.2 of 2013 is declared as illegal and it is set aside. Consequently, the respondents are directed to examine the select list thoroughly, apply the rule of reservation and segregate the candidates who are improperly selected from the properly selected candidates and appoint the petitioners according to their merit and by applying the rule of reservation pursuant to their respective appointment orders.
